Onboard each of the satellites are four highly accurate atomic clocks. The resonance frequency of
one of these clocks generates the following time pulses and frequencies required for operations.
• The 50Hz data pulse
• The C/A (Coarse/Acquisition) code (a PRN-
Code broadcast at 1.023MHz), which modulates the data using an exclusive-
or operation (EXOR)16 spreading the data over a 2MHz bandwidth.
• The frequency of the civil L1 carrier (1575.42MHz) The data modulated by the C/A code mo
dulates the L1 carrier in turn by using Binary-Phase-Shift-
Keying (BPSK)17. With every change in the modulated data there is a 180° change in the L1 car
rier phase.

The current operational low earth orbit satellite phone networks are
able to track transceiver units with accuracy of a few kilometres
using Doppler shift calculation from the satellite.
The co-ordinates are sent back to the transceiver unit where they can
be read using AT commands or a graphical user interface.
